What detox actually means, and why timing matters

Detox is the clinically handled procedure of withdrawing from alcohol or medicines safely, normally over several days. It is not the same as therapy. Detox clears the prompt physical dangers and pain sufficient to go into programming with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this distinction can be life saving. Extreme withdrawal can set off seizures or an unsafe state called delirium tremens, typically co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A medical team in a rehab facility can track important symptoms and signs, then dosage medications like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Lots of programs likewise include thiamine and various other vitamins to prevent neurological problems that are common in long-term alcohol use.

Drug detox in Charlotte follows comparable concepts yet various medications. Opioid withdrawal, while hardly ever life threatening, can be ruthless. Nausea, muscle mass aches, sleep problems, and anxiousness integrate into a wall that few individuals climb alone. Medicines like buprenorphine or methadone simplicity signs and reduce desires. Some programs begin extended-release naltrexone after a complete detoxification period.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can lug a heavy anxiety with sleep modifications,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The ideal setup screens for suicidality and deals with mood signs together with cravings.

Most alcohol detoxification stays last three to seven days. For opioids, stabilization can be faster if medication begins early, sometimes one to three days before transitioning into continuous treatment. The window between detox discharge and rehab admission is essential. Approximation from program records recommend that if treatment does not start within around 72 hours, the danger of relapse increases sharply. Good programs resolve this with same-campus changes, or with deliberate transport and a warm handoff.

The Charlotte landscape: what exists and exactly how it fits together

Charlotte's network consists of hospital-based units, standalone rehab facilities,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Huge health and wellness systems in the city offer emergency situation st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they companion with neighborhood companies to proceed care. Residential programs have a tendency to sit outside the city core for space and privacy, while extensive outpatient solutions collection near significant ro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for ease of access.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and medication rehabilitation Charlotte used in marketing, yet what issues is degree of care and scientific fit, not the label.

When you look rehabilitation near me or rehab facility Charlotte, expect to locate:

    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 insurance coverage for complex cases. Residential or inpatient rehab that provides room, board, and structured therapy. Partial hospitalization programs, commonly 5 days weekly, six hours per day. Intensive outpatient programs, typically three or 4 days weekly, three hours per day. Office-based drug for addiction therapy with therapy add-ons. Sober living homes that offer a healing environment yet not scientific care.

A strong system allows people go up or down as needs change. A young specialist with modest alcohol usage problem, steady real estate, and solid family support may step from alcohol detox right into intensive outpatient, then see a therapist two times weekly. Somebody with extreme with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ar disorder, and limited assistance in the house may maintain in hospital, complete 28 days of household therapy, and after that move to partial hospitalization.

A brief checklist for selecting a program quickly

When the phone remains in your hand and the clock is ticking, concentrate on 5 inquiries that anticipate high quality and fit.

    What degrees of care do you supply on one university or through official partnerships, and how do you shift people between them without gaps? How do you integrate psychological health and wellness treatment, consisting of on-site psychiatry, medicine management, and evidence-based treatments for injury and state of mind disorders? What is your approach to drugs for addiction treatment, consisting of buprenorphine, methadone coordination, naltrexone, acamprosate, and disulfiram? Are you recognized by a nationwide body and staffed by certified clinicians, and what are your common caseloads for therapists and nurses? How do you involve families or encouraging others, and what aftercare preparation takes place before discharge with concrete consultations set?

If a program can answer those clearly, with specifics instead of slogans, you get on strong ground. You can then ask the practicals about insurance coverage, waiting lists, and transportation.

Accreditation, staffing, and capability: the details that matter more than the lobby

An eye-catching site and a tranquil picture gallery do not deal with dependency. Accreditation by organizations such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ehab center Charlotte citizens could visit has actually met nationwide safety and security and high quality standards. It is not a guarantee, yet it is a standard. Ask how many accredited clinicians are on each shift. In detox, you desire 24/7 nursing and ready accessibility to a medical company. In domestic programs, day-to-day scientific contact and routine psychoanalyst access make a concrete difference, especially for co-occurring clinical dep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.

Capacity can be both a positive and a care. Bigger universities can use specialty tracks, groups at multiple times, and much faster transitions. They can likewise really feel much less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ller centers may supply a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, however they could battle with intricate medical needs or after-hours protection. There is no solitary right answer. Match the program to the individual's threat account and support system.

Alcohol rehabilitation vs medicine rehabilitation: why the difference can mislead

Marketing attracts lines in between alcohol rehab and medicine rehabilitation, yet the most effective rehabilitation facilities deal with material usage as a family members of conditions that often overlap, then individualize treatment. Many people utilize alcohol to soften the accident after stimulants. Others utilize benzodiazepines prescribed for stress and anxiety and locate themselves physically reliant. A durable rehabilitation center Charlotte program displays for all compounds, checks the prescription medicine database when suitable, and sets a strategy that lines up with the individual's goals. That strategy could consist of tapering a benzodiazepine safely while starting antidepressants and skills-based therapy, or preserving on buprenorphine while working with alcohol triggers.

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not settle for parallel tracks

Roughly fifty percent of people in substance usage therapy satisfy requirements for at the very least one mental w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ms double di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ear throughout program materials, yet the depth differs. Look for integrated treatment, not different timetables. You desire specialists trained in c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ior modification who function along with prescribers. Injury services issue, whether that implies EMDR, prolonged exposure, or skills-based groups for psychological policy. Measurement-based care, where clinicians use brief, validated devices to track depression, stress and anxiety, or cravings weekly, assists teams readjust timely as opposed to by hunch.

One customer I dealt with gotten in medicine detox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stabilization, his testing flagged serious PTSD signs linked to a cars and truck accident years earlier. He had actually tried to white-knuckle via flashbacks. In therapy, we presented prazosin in the evening for problems and started trauma-focused therapy when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stinence and adequate rest. His cravings made extra sense when the origin fear was named and dealt with. Unaddressed injury is an usual relapse danger, not a side note.

Medications for addiction treatment: signals of a modern, humane program

If a program declines every kind of drug, think about that a warning unless they can verbalize a very particular clinical reason. For alcoholism ther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ong evidence for lowering go back to hefty drinking. Disulfiram can aid when supervised and properly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are shown to reduced death, keep people in treatment, and cut immoral usage.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for highly inspired individuals that complete full detoxification. Some Charlotte programs initiate medicine in detox and keep with household and outpatient levels, coordinating with external prescribers if needed. That continuity avoids voids that commonly lead to relapse.

It is additionally sensible for somebody to decrease drug at first. Good medical professionals discuss alternatives, file preferences, and take another look at the conversation as recuperation develops. The trick is visibility and the ability to supply or collaborate medication if the individual selects it later.

Cost, insurance, and the realities of paying for care

Charlotte's payers include commercial insurance companies, Medicare, and Medicaid via taken care of treatment strategies. Advantages vary extensively. One strategy might accept seven days of alcohol detoxification however require day-to-day medical updates to expand. One more could favor outpatient if standards do not show acute risk. Residential remains frequently run two to four weeks for insured clients, depending upon progression and benefits. Self-pay prices vary by program, however detoxification days are generally one of the most pricey because of clinical staffing, while extensive outpatient is the least pricey per day.

Get a straight solution about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ab center validates benefits and gets approvals before admission, and whether they offer a composed quote of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, demand a thorough declaration of services consisted of. Clarity on expense reduces mid-stay stress and anxiety for households and frees the customer to concentrate on recovery.

If you or a liked one needs to protect employment, bear in mind that several workers get approved for job-protected leave under the Household and Medical Leave Act. Temporary impairment advantages can balance out revenue loss throughout property remains. Human resources divisions handle these demands regularly and typically appreciate very early notice once a beginning date is set.

Group version, neighborhood, and the question of 12‑step

Charlotte hosts a broad mix of mutual-aid communities. Conventional 12‑step teams like AA and NA run conferences across areas early morning to night. Alternatives such as SMART Healing, LifeRing, Haven Recovery, and Ladies for Soberness additionally preserve a presence. A modern rehab center uses exposure to numerous options and assists customers pick what fits. For someone allergic to 12‑step language, forcing action work is detrimental. For another person, the structure and sponsorship design can be a lifeline. The work of treatment is not to win an ideology, but to build a recuperation community that lasts.

Family involvement and borders that heal

Addiction hardly ever isolates to a single person's habits. Family members flex around it. In therapy, well-run programs welcome households or partners into organized sessions where everyone discovers abilities without reliving every hurt. Limits obtain clear. Moms and dads of adult children learn to different support from rescue. Couples exercise timeouts and tranquil manuscripts. When households understand post-acute withdrawal signs and symptoms, sleep disturbance, and the value of drug adherence, they respond to very early stumbles extra constructively.

In Charlotte, family members support can continue after discharge with local teams and specialists who concentrate on substance use and codependency. One of the most efficient aftercare strategies consist of visits for the family as well as the customer. Healing is contagious when the system moves together.

Aftercare that sticks: from schedule to habit

The day therapy finishes is not the day recuperation is tested. That examination shows up in a regular Tuesday two months later when a conference runs late, you avoid dinner, and an old bar rests in between your office and the car park. Excellent aftercare programs plan for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, demand a concrete strategy with days,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, medicine follow-ups, healing meetings, and a primary care visit. Plug them right into a schedule with suggestions. Add recovery peers to your phone faves. If rest is delicate, front-load night supports and keep very early bedtime till energy degrees rise.

For many individuals, intensive outpatient for 6 to ten weeks offers a strong bridge back to function or institution. Sober living can expand the recovery atmosphere while freedom expands. If you started bu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the next two drug appointments prior to leaving. Gaps reproduce doubt and missed doses.

Charlotte employers frequently support graduated returns to function. Work out a step-by-step timetable preferably. Eating well, moistening, and routine workout sound ordinary, but they maintain mood and lower yearnings more than the majority of people anticipate. When problems happen, measure the size properly. A lapse is info and a timely to tighten up assistances, not evidence that treatment failed.

Edge situations and difficult telephone calls: excellence is not required

I commonly listen to variants of this: I can not go to household because of my children. Or, I attempted medicine as soon as and it did not work. Or, I am not all set to quit everything, only alcohol. Fact is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can benefit single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and nights return home. A second trial of naltrexone can be successful when paired with regular therapy and food planning to curb evening appetite, a trigger that torpedoed the initial test. If a person insists on keeping periodic marijuana while they quit consuming, some programs will still approve them, established clear boundaries, and revisit the objective after trust fund constructs. Damage reduction saves lives and often progresses into complete abstaining as stability grows.

Another difficult telephone call is when clinical depression looks extreme however the individual is early in detoxification. Several signs and symptoms boost when sleep normalizes and materials clear. That is not a reason to overlook risk. Excellent groups stage interventions, support sleep, and display mood very closely, then start or readjust antidepressants when sufficient data build up over a week or more. In immediate cases, healthcare facility psychiatry supplies safety until stabilization.

Frequently Ask Questions about Addiction Treatment Center in Charlotte, NC


What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.

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.

How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.

What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?

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.

What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.

How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?

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
